The reason I don't think the Cards are going to draft a QB is that their new coach is a defensive guy and they are tethered to the Murray contract for at least one more season. It would be different if he was a hotshot OC who might be pounding the table for one of these QBs, but he isn't. He's a 40 year old first time head coach with a 35 year old OC and a 29 year old DC and they basically get a free season to see if things work with Murray. If not, they can throw him under the bus and draft a QB in 2024 with a likely early pick given how weak their roster looks right now. It's not a tank job, but they have a scapegoat if it turns into one.

For the same reasons, however, Ossefort is going to want to trade down from #3 for more picks and future picks. The only question is if Gannon is excited enough about Anderson to convince him to stay put, which he might be, but it's a risk for a first time head coach to stick his neck out like that unless he's very sure. The smarter path is trading down as much as possible, stocking up on rookies and playing them while the team sheds bad contracts, and then drafting a QB at the top of the 2024 class.
